Ford Edge vs Ford Escape
Ford Edge vs Ford Escape

These two models (Ford Edge vs Ford Escape) are the strong, robust sellers for the blue oval. The escape and edge often make up a great volume in terms of the dealership. However, during this model year, the escape has lost some of its squared-off charms in favor of more bodywork. After some boatload of changes last year, Edge soldiers on with no such major differences though however changes in terms of color palette and option packages.

Both are two-row, five-passenger vehicles and offer a wide choice of powertrains and optional all-wheel drive. Now let have a discussion in detail to find out which one is best suitable.

Powertrains Options in Ford Edge vs Ford Escape

Ford Escape

There is no undershoot of powertrain options in the freshly hewn escape. It has 1.5-liter turbocharged three-cylinder making 180 hp moreover available with front or all-wheel drive. A boosted 2.0-liter mill makes a healthy 250 ponies and sends power to all four wheels.

Hybrid models use a 2.5-liter inline-four and it pairs with electric propulsion which makes about 200 horsepower. The plug-in hybrid model makes more juice and this is all due to the robust pack of electrons.

In the Escape, Ford’s 250 hp turbo-four is a great choice but it has extra weight. If it goes in the budget, hit for the ST.

Ford Edge

All Edge models except the sporty ST and are powered by a turbocharged 2.0-liter four-banger which makes 250 horsepower and 275 lb-ft of torque.

On all the non-STs the front-wheel drive is standard with all-wheel-drive showing up as an option. The ST Zooty comes with all-wheel drive as standard equipment.

It earns a 2.7 liter turbocharged V6, good for 335 ponies and 380 units of twist. Every edge has an eight-speed automatic transmission.

Ford Edge vs Ford Escape: Fuel Economy

Ford Escape

It has front-wheel drive 1.5-liter powertrain which is estimated to get 33 mpg in highway driving. It also has 27 mpg while on a city cycle drive. Combining, that should make for 30 mpg. By adding all-wheel drive wills likely ding numbers by about 1 mpg. The versions in terms of hybrid will likely post numbers into the ’30s.

Ford Edge

Ford reckons front-wheel-drive versions. This vehicle should return 21 mpg around town and 29 mpg on the highway. Adding all wheels drops each of these numbers by a single mpg. It is worth noting that the numbers in terms of power listed at the beginning of the post are acquired with expensive 93 octane fuel. The edge versions have a larger fuel tank nonetheless the presence of powertrain gear.

Considering the above points, small footprints make escape the fuel economy a winner.
